Poulan 2300cva improper acceleration
« on: January 19, 2012, 01:51:22 pm »
I have a 20 y/o Poulan 2300cva.  Before Christmas it started bogging down after several minutes of operation.  It would accelerate properly and then the chain would stop during a cut.  It had gotten only intermittent use until five or six years ago and has been used to cut fallen trees on our 4 ac residential property outlined by trees and for clearing a 19 ac site where we plan to build.  The only maintenance over the 20 yrs was to change the spark plug and tune to carb.  When I started to clean the air filter, it disintegrated in my hand.  I replaced it and the spark plug and retuned the carb.  I saw air in the fuel line so replaced the fuel line and filter.  While it starts better, I cannot get it to accelerate properly.  As I back it off from lean to rich it starts to accelerate better and then the idle speed tails off.  Adjusting the fast idle has no effect on acceleration.  While I have no previous experience with chain saw engines, I have done a great deal of work on cars and lawn mowers in the past 40 years, including rebuilding a Volvo engine, several different kinds of automobile carbs, domestic and import, and lawnmower carbs.  Is there anything else to do before I rebuild the carb?  Thanks!

Re: Poulan 2300cva improper acceleration
« Reply #1 on: January 19, 2012, 02:12:05 pm »
Make sure you replaced fuel line from carb all the way to fuel filter in tank. 2 pieces.

Check compression. 120+ wanted, 140 150 great

Sounds like carb rebuild time. The diaphragm is probably stiff now and not working properly.  Kits $5 to $12 and about 30mins to do. Pay attention taking apart and or back together.

Mowers4u is a good place to call or search their  website to get carb kits.  If you know your carb numbers and type.
